ABOUT BRI
Briana is an NYC/Hudson Valley-based actor and singer, originally from a small town outside of Fort Worth, Texas where she grew up riding horses, eating queso, and making home movies with her friends. From an early age she began dance lessons, which led her to musicals, then to plays, and finally to her love of film.
She recently graduated from New York University's Tisch School of the Arts, receiving a BFA in Drama and a minor in Psychology. During her time at NYU, Briana trained at the Stella Adler Studio of Acting, New Studio on Broadway (MT), and Stonestreet Studios.
Briana is passionate about creating honest, nuanced, and empowered female characters, and looks forward to working with other creatives in the pursuit of storytelling.
